If you're planning a trip to Europe or are looking for a reason to go there, taking delivery of a new car at the factory can make sense.
First, your transportation needs on the Continent will be handled. Cross off a rental-car bill, as all you'll pay for is fuel. Fuel costs more in Europe than it does here, but you'll be in your new car!
Second, automakers give a price break on European delivery. Audi takes 5 percent off its sticker. Plus, the company picks up one night's lodging at a four- or five-star hotel near the Ingolstadt delivery center. And it takes care of registration and insurance for up to five weeks of European travel. Other manufacturers have similar programs and discounts.
Audi works hard to make you feel like a VIP. After arriving in Munich's airport, you are met by a driver who loads your bags into an Audi A8L W12 and whisks you to either your hotel or the delivery center. At the Audi Forum delivery center, you get a VIP wristband. This pass allows you (and those with you) access to the excellent restaurant adjacent to the center, as well as to the Museum Mobile, which documents Audi's history. The museum-one of the best in the world-is worth a few hours' tour.
